The Upper Merion Camera Club (UMCC) objectives are to focus on the promotion and improvement of creative photography and its applications, and to facilitate the exchange of information and ideas
in this field.
General membership meetings take place Wednesday evenings from September through May starting at 7:30 P.M. Meetings are held at the Port Kennedy Presbyterian Church on Old Valley Forge Road
(near US 422 and the Valley Forge Towers) in King of Prussia, PA. See the Meeting Schedule for details. The main program is usually a speaker or presenter on
photographic topics; either a "how to" program or slide shows on travel or other subjects of interest. The last Wednesday of the month is reserved for the monthly competition, which is judged either
by a panel of three "inside" judges, or a judge from outside the club, an experienced photographer who can give an independent evaluation of the members' photographs.
Throughout the year, members gather together and travel to various local and regional destinations in search of photographic opportunities. During the club year of September to May, we may plan
fall, winter, or spring day trips. During the summer break, we keep a full calendar for Wednesday evenings. We also often gather informally
Saturday morning and head out with gear in tow.
The club operates on a not-for-profit basis. Our regular meetings and programs are open to guests free of charge. Membership is required to participate in competitions.
Dues for the September through May camera club year are $30.
Upper Merion Camera Club is a member of the The Photographic Society of America (PSA) and The
Delaware Valley Council of Camera Clubs.
